Identifying the defendant
Unlike typical car accident cases, truck accidents may involve multiple parties. It is essential to identify all the parties responsible in your case to ensure you can receive the most compensation for your injuries and losses.
Although it's difficult to determine who was the cause of the case of a truck accident it is possible to get an accurate view of the event through investigative techniques that are specialized for these types of cases. You can also make use of various witnesses and records to back your claim.
Driver errors are the primary reason for truck accidents. Driver error is the most common reason for truck accidents.
Another common reason for truck crashes is a defect in the component. Manufacturers are accountable for parts that are defective or damaged that causes an accident and maintenance companies may be held accountable if they fail to correct the defect or replace the component.
A team of experts in accident reconstruction will investigate the exact spot where the accident occurred and document eyewitness reports, sight lines and skid marks as well as other aspects. They will also collect data from the vehicle’s "black box" and its electronic log-in device as well as documents such as maintenance reports, manifests for cargo, hours of service records of truck drivers and communication systems.
It is essential to collect this information prior to the start of litigation. Defense attorneys hide information from the plaintiffs. This could include the schedule of the company and its route along with satellite tracking information and even communications from their home base regarding the accident.

Identifying the Injuries
Injuries sustained in a truck accident can be serious and can have a lasting effect on your life. You might be unable to work or carry out daily tasks, leaving you exhausted and depressed.
Broken bones as well as whiplash and head trauma are the most common injuries you could suffer in a truck crash. The force of the collision is a major factor in creating bone fractures. These fractures require surgery, castings, and physical therapy to be repaired. They can take months to heal and can have lasting consequences for your health.
Burns are another common ailment that can be caused by the accident of a truck. Fuel tanks in trucks are more likely than those of passenger vehicles to rupture in an accident. This can cause fires.
If you've been in an accident with a truck, and you sustained burns that can be very painful, and can leave permanent disfigurement. If you have suffered severe burns, you might require reconstructive surgery to restore your skin and face.
Spinal cord injuries are a common kind of truck accident injury. The sudden impact to the spinal cord can cause damage that will forever alter how you move, feel and think.
Other injuries you could sustain in a truck accident include muscle strains and whiplash. These types of injuries can be minor, such as mild neck pain or they can be more serious, such as a herniated disc which causes a lot of pain and prevents you from moving or working.
Whiplash is among the most frequent back injuries truck drivers are afflicted with. It occurs when your head is struck by the steering wheel or dashboard, or any other hard surface.
It can trigger a range of symptoms, such as the sensation of tingling or numbness, for instance, in your arms, hands, or legs. It can also affect your breathing and heart rate.
Ribs-related injuries are also commonplace in truck crashes. These injuries could cause internal bleeding and organ damage. If not treated immediately these injuries could turn fatal.
You may also suffer abrasions and scratches on your body. These injuries are more prevalent after you've been thrown out of the vehicle or hit by a piece of debris that flew from the cab.
